【二进制数转成十进制数】在计算机科学和数字系统中,二进制数是一种非常基础的表示方式。它由0和1两个数字组成,每一位代表一个2的幂次。将二进制数转换为十进制数,是理解计算机内部数据处理的重要步骤。
二进制转十进制的基本方法
将二进制数转换为十进制数,需要按照每一位的权值进行计算。具体来说,每一位的权值是2的该位位置(从右往左,从0开始)次方。然后将所有位的值相加,即可得到对应的十进制数。
例如:二进制数 `1011` 转换为十进制:
- 第一位(最右边):1 × 2⁰ = 1
- 第二位:1 × 2¹ = 2
- 第三位:0 × 2² = 0
- 第四位:1 × 2³ = 8
总和为:1 + 2 + 0 + 8 = 11
因此,二进制数 `1011` 对应的十进制数是 11。
二进制数与十进制数对照表
二进制数 | 十进制数 |
0 | 0 |
1 | 1 |
10 | 2 |
11 | 3 |
100 | 4 |
101 | 5 |
110 | 6 |
111 | 7 |
1000 | 8 |
1001 | 9 |
1010 | 10 |
1011 | 11 |
1100 | 12 |
1101 | 13 |
1110 | 14 |
1111 | 15 |
小结
二进制数转换为十进制数的过程相对简单,只需逐位计算其权值并求和即可。掌握这一转换方法,有助于更好地理解计算机中的数据表示与运算逻辑。对于初学者而言,通过表格形式记忆常见的二进制与十进制对应关系,也是一种高效的学习方式。